Course content
The course "Scientific image of the world" consists of one content part. The educational discipline is designed to acquaint students of the humanities faculties of the University with the history of the emergence and development of science in society, the achievements of its individual branches. This discipline should contribute to the formation in students of a modern scientific outlook, without which it is difficult to imagine the civilization of the 21st century.

Planned learning activities and teaching methods
Learning activities: lectures, individual consultations, independent work. Teaching methods: explanatory and illustrative method, method of problem-based learning (problem lecture), heuristic method, educational discussion, preparation and discussion of presentations, independent work of students.
Assessment methods and criteria
Current assessment: test, presentation, modular control work. Final assessment - credit. Evaluation criteria for each form of control are given in the course program.
